The basic uxplay options for R Pi are `uxplay -v4l2 [-vs <videosink>]`.
The choice `<videosink>` = `glimagesink` is sometimes useful. On a
system without X11 (like R Pi OS Lite) with framebuffer video, use
`<videosink>` = `kmssink`. With the Wayland video compositor, use
`<videosink>` = `waylandsink`. For convenience, these options are also
available combined in options `-rpi`, `-rpigl` `-rpifb`, `-rpiwl`,
respectively provided for X11, X11 with OpenGL, framebuffer, and Wayland
systems. You may find that just "`uxplay`", (*without* `-v4l2` or
`-rpi*` options, which lets GStreamer try to find the best video
solution by itself) provides the best results.
The basic uxplay options for R Pi are
`uxplay [-v4l2] [-vs <videosink>]`. The choice `<videosink>` =
`glimagesink` is sometimes useful. On a system without X11 (like R Pi OS
Lite) with framebuffer video, use `<videosink>` = `kmssink`. With the
Wayland video compositor, use `<videosink>` = `waylandsink`. For
convenience, these options are also available combined in options
`-rpi`, `-rpigl` `-rpifb`, `-rpiwl`, respectively provided for X11, X11
with OpenGL, framebuffer, and Wayland systems. You may find that just
"`uxplay`", (*without* `-v4l2` or `-rpi*` options, which lets GStreamer
try to find the best video solution by itself) provides the best
results.
